Detailed analysis of the Toyota GR Supra A90 Final Edition · 441 CV (2025)
General description
The 2025 Toyota GR Supra A90 Final Edition is the culmination of a legend, a sports car that evokes passion and adrenaline from the very first moment. With its 441 HP gasoline engine and a 6-speed manual transmission, this rear-wheel-drive coupe promises a pure and exciting driving experience, a true homage to Toyota's sporting heritage.
Driving experience
Behind the wheel of the GR Supra A90 Final Edition, the connection to the road is immediate and visceral. The precise steering and sports suspension, with McPherson struts at the front and a multi-link setup at the rear, invite you to devour every curve. The inline six-cylinder engine, with its 441 HP and 500 Nm of torque, pushes with brutal force, catapulting you from 0 to 100 km/h in just 4.3 seconds. The manual gearbox adds an extra layer of immersion, allowing you to squeeze every gear and feel the engine's roar. It's a machine designed to thrill, to make you feel alive with every acceleration and braking, with 395 mm ventilated discs at the front and 345 mm at the rear ensuring powerful stopping.
Design and aesthetics
The design of the Toyota GR Supra A90 Final Edition is a statement of intent. Its aggressive and muscular lines, with a low and wide silhouette, leave no doubt about its sporty character. The sharp headlights, prominent air intakes, and sculpted rear with an integrated diffuser and dual exhaust outlets all contribute to an aesthetic that radiates speed and dynamism. The 19-inch front and 20-inch rear wheels, shod with high-performance tires, complete a visually striking package that attracts all eyes.
Technology and features
Beneath its sporty skin, the GR Supra A90 Final Edition integrates advanced technology to enhance the driving experience. Its 3.0-liter engine, with direct injection, turbo, and intercooler, is a work of engineering that combines power and efficiency. The electric power steering, sensitive to speed, offers precise response, while the Stop&Start system helps optimize fuel consumption. Although it focuses on driving purity, it does not neglect elements that make life on board more pleasant, maintaining a balance between analog and digital for an immersive experience.
Competition
In the pure sports car segment, the Toyota GR Supra A90 Final Edition faces rivals such as the Porsche 718 Cayman, the Alpine A110, or the BMW Z4 M40i, with which it shares platform and engine. Each offers its own interpretation of sportiness, but the Supra stands out for its focus on driver connection, its distinctive design, and the inherent reliability of the Toyota brand, offering an exciting alternative with a very marked character.
